Understanding Polymers

Before diving into the training aspect, let’s lay the foundation by understanding what polymers are. Polymers are macromolecules composed of repeating subunits called monomers. These long chains of monomers result in materials with unique physical and chemical properties. Polyurea, for example, is a remarkable polymer that finds applications as a protective coating due to its exceptional durability and chemical resistance.

Industries Benefitting from Polymer Training

The impact of polymer training extends across various industries. Let’s explore a few industries that rely heavily on the knowledge and expertise imparted through polymer training.

1. Construction

Polymer-based materials are revolutionizing the construction industry. Polymer composites, such as fiber-reinforced polymers (FRP), are lightweight, yet incredibly strong, making them ideal for structural reinforcement. By undergoing polymer training, professionals in construction can identify the most suitable polymers and composites for specific applications, improving the durability and strength of buildings and infrastructure.

2. Automotive

The automotive industry is another field that benefits immensely from polymer training. Polymers have replaced traditional materials in car manufacturing, leading to increased fuel efficiency, reduced weight, and improved safety. Polymer training equips automotive professionals with the skills to develop innovative components and materials, contributing to advancements in electric vehicles, aerodynamics, and crash protection.

3. Electronics

Polymers have become crucial in the electronics industry due to their electrical conductivity, thermal stability, and flexibility. Through polymer training, professionals gain a deep understanding of the specific requirements for electronic applications and learn to develop conductive polymers, dielectric materials, and advanced packaging solutions.

The Training Process

Polymer training programs typically cover a wide range of topics, including polymer chemistry, synthesis techniques, polymer characterization, and processing methods. Hands-on laboratory work is often a crucial component, allowing trainees to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ios. Additionally, participants learn how to analyze and troubleshoot common issues that may arise during polymer production or application.
